How Much Do Electrician Services Cost in Carver?

In Carver, you can generally expect to pay between $41 and $62 per hour for electrical work. The final quote for your specific project will be based on how long it will take to complete and any necessary new equipment. Companies may also quote higher rates for jobs that are dangerous, difficult, or require multiple workers on-site.

What Services Do Electricians Offer?

Electricians in Carver specialize in a wide array of services, ranging from minor fixes to whole-home electrical improvements. Some common services include the following:

  • System installation: Electricians can hook up new electrical systems, including outdoor lighting and appliances. To ensure you get an accurate installation estimate, tell the electrician if you've already have the equipment or if you want the company to place the order on your behalf.
  • Surge protection: A certified electrician can assess your home’s electrical setup and install surge protection measures at key points to shield you and your electronics. Surge protection steps can save you money in the long term.
  • Electrical repairs: If the wall sockets in your bedroom stop working or your fridge breaks down, an electrician can diagnose and correct the issue. Many electricians provide free inspections, during which they’ll assess the problem, suggest possible causes, and provide a quote for the necessary fixes.
  • Electrical upgrades: Upgrading your home's wiring is one of many electrical upgrades that professional electricians can do. From replacing old prong outlets to replacing worn wires with newer, better-insulated ones, a pro can handle a wide range of electrical tasks. A licensed electrician can also make panel upgrades for your whole home.

What are the Licensing Requirements for Electricians in Massachusetts?

Electrical jobs can be hazardous if done improperly. It's very crucial to hire a certified electrician with the necessary knowledge and training. The Massachusetts government issues four separate classes of electrical licenses. Most residential electricians will hold either a Class A (Master Electrician) or Class B (Journeyman Electrician) license. Visit the Massachusetts Board of State Examiners of Electricians Licensing website for more details and to verify a contractor's good standing.

Some electricians take additional steps by obtaining extra certifications from respected agencies like the Occupational Safety and Health Administration. Private certifications can demonstrate an electrician's dedication to mastering rigorous safety standards and best practices. Be sure to ask each electrician about any additional training they've completed.

Plan to have your entire home's electrical system examined every 3–5 years. An electrician can detect potential issues and recommend efficient upgrades during the visit.

You can reduce the risk of power surges by setting up protective devices, whether for outlets and individual appliances or by getting your whole house surge protected. A qualified electrician can set up the necessary equipment for you. Further, avoid overloading outlets with multiple power strips or large appliances, and never plug a three-prong plug into a two-prong outlet. If you notice signs of electrical issues — such as sparks, hot outlets or switch plates, burning smells, or flickering lights — disconnect power to the area and get a professional evaluation.

You may discover your electrical system needs an upgrade when you see a surge in your energy bills. Defective or old electrical equipment is less energy-efficient, causing your power consumption to increase. Flickering lights or a tripping circuit breaker can also signal system-wide issues. If you notice warm switch plates, strange smells, or sparks, turn off power to the affected area and contact a local electrician.
